UNPKG

@inkline/inkline

Version:

Inkline is the Vue.js UI/UX Library built for creating your next design system

37 lines (36 loc) 1.05 kB
import { sizePropValidator } from '../../mixins'; declare const _default: import("vue").DefineComponent<{ /** * @description The icon to be displayed * @type String * @default * @name name */ name: { type: StringConstructor; default: string; }; /** * The size variant of the icon * @type sm | md | lg * @default md * @name size */ size: { type: StringConstructor; default: () => string; validator: typeof sizePropValidator; }; }, () => import("vue").VNode<import("vue").RendererNode, import("vue").RendererElement, { [key: string]: any; }>, unknown, {}, {}, import("vue").ComponentOptionsMixin, import("vue").ComponentOptionsMixin, Record<string, any>, string, import("vue").VNodeProps & import("vue").AllowedComponentProps & import("vue").ComponentCustomProps, Readonly<{ name?: unknown; size?: unknown; } & { name: string; size: string; } & {}>, { name: string; size: string; }>; export default _default;